0

20、21、および 23 の 3 つの API レベルがダウンロードされているという問題があります。新しいプロジェクトを作成すると、API 23 が自動的に選択されますが、API 20 プロジェクトが必要です。

ここに画像の説明を入力

build.gradlefile に変更を加えると、次のようになります

android {
    compileSdkVersion 20 // previously 23
    buildToolsVersion "20.0.0"

    defaultConfig {
        applicationId "com.abc.xyz"
        minSdkVersion 15
        targetSdkVersion 20// previously 23
        versionCode 1
        versionName "1.0"
    }

明らかな多数のエラーが発生し始めますが、簡単に解決できません

ここに画像の説明を入力

私の問題は、API 23 にはこれが必要ないため、新しい新鮮な API 20 プロジェクトを開始できない理由です。

異なる API を異なるディレクトリに配置する必要がありますか? または、これを実現する他の方法があります。

4

2 に答える 2

0

android studio でFILE -> Project Structureに移動します。

コンパイル済みの SDK バージョンを変更し、変更を適用しますコンパイルSDKを変更

于 2015-11-05T10:40:25.987 に答える